Feds raid motorcycle gang clubhouses in Indiana

INDIANAPOLIS — Federal agents have raided several sites used by the Outlaws motorcycle gang in Indianapolis and Fort Wayne.

Those raids Wednesday morning included an Outlaws clubhouse in Fort Wayne. The Journal Gazette reports FBI agents boxed up evidence and searched the building with a dog.

FBI spokesman Drew Northern tells The Associated Press that agents also raided locations in Indianapolis as part of a “takedown” involving the Outlaws. He says court documents are sealed and he couldn’t comment further.

U.S. attorney’s office spokesman Tim Horty says a news conference will be held in Indianapolis Wednesday afternoon.

Last year, a federal judge in Virginia sentenced the Outlaws national president to 20 years in prison on racketeering charges related to a violent turf war with the rival Hells Angels.
